Some common tasks Junior Business Analysts perform include:

Data Collection and Analysis: Gathering data from various sources, such as reports, systems, and stakeholders, to identify trends, issues, or opportunities.

Documentation: Creating and maintaining documentation, including business requirements, process maps, and reports, which help support decision-making.

Assisting in Requirements Gathering: Participating in meetings with stakeholders (clients, users, or team members) to understand their needs and documenting those requirements for development teams.

Process Improvement: Analyzing current business processes and identifying areas where efficiency or productivity can be improved.

Supporting Solution Development: Helping to design or improve systems, software, or business processes based on the data and insights gathered.

Communication: Working closely with stakeholders and cross-functional teams to ensure understanding and alignment on business objectives.

Overall, Junior Business Analysts are in a learning phase of their careers, gaining experience to take on more complex responsibilities as they grow in the role. They typically report to Senior Business Analysts, Managers, or Project Leaders.

Salary Ranges

The salary for a Junior Business Analyst can vary depending on several factors, such as location, industry, level of experience, and company size. However, the salary ranges are typically $50,000 to $70,000 per year. Some companies also offer performance-based bonuses or annual bonuses that can range from a few thousand dollars to a percentage of the salary.

Tech and Finance: Junior Business Analysts working in technology or financial sectors often earn higher salaries due to the high demand and technical nature of the work.

Healthcare, Retail, and Nonprofits: These sectors may offer slightly lower compensation but could offer other benefits, such as more work-life balance or job stability.
